寻线玩具中的指令同步处理方法和系统与流程

文档序号:32346409发布日期:2022-11-26 11:28阅读:来源:国知局

技术特征:
1.一种寻线玩具中的指令同步处理方法,其特征在于,包括:步骤s1:在第一时间段中,寻线获取第一线路上的指令卡展示的指令,并按照队列的数据结构存储指令,得到第一指令队列;步骤s2:在第二时间段中,触发所述第一指令队列中的指令依次执行,并实时触发实时寻线移动获取的第二线路上的指令卡展示的指令;其中,所述第二时间段晚于第一时间段。2.根据权利要求1所述的寻线玩具中的指令同步处理方法,其特征在于,所述步骤s1包括:步骤s1.1:记录从第一线路上寻线获取到各对相邻指令卡展现指令之间的时间间隔;步骤s1.2:根据所述时间间隔,对所述第一指令队列中的指令标注触发执行的时间点,相邻指令的时间点之间时间的间隔等于对应的所述时间间隔。在所述步骤s2中,按照所述时间点,触发所述第一指令队列中的指令依次执行;其中,第一线路的寻线速率与第二线路的寻线速率相等。3.根据权利要求2所述的寻线玩具中的指令同步处理方法,其特征在于,所述步骤s2包括:步骤s2.1:在第二线路上获取延时执行指令卡展示的延时指令;步骤s2.2:按照所述延时指令指示的时间,触发所述第一指令队列中的第一个指令开始执行。4.根据权利要求3所述的寻线玩具中的指令同步处理方法,其特征在于,还包括:步骤sa:在第三时间段中,在第二线路上寻路移动,获取延时执行指令卡展示的延时指令;步骤sb:在第三时间段中,按照所述延时指令指示的时间,暂停后继续寻路移动;步骤sc:在第三时间段中,在所述时间点时进行暂停后继续寻路移动,直到停留在第一指令队列中的最后一个时间点时的位置;其中,所述暂停时经过的时间,不计入相邻指令的时间点之间时间的间隔;所述暂停时经过的时间大于等于1秒钟;所述第三时间段位于所述第一时间段与第二时间段之间,或者,所述第三时间段位于所述第二时间段之后。5.根据权利要求1所述的寻线玩具中的指令同步处理方法,其特征在于,第一线路与第二线路为同一条线路或者为不同的线路;第一线路上获取的指令卡的尺寸相等于第二线路上获取的指令卡的尺寸;在所述步骤s2中,触发所述第一指令队列中的无间隔排列的指令卡展示的指令依次执行,并实时触发第二线路上的无间隔排列的指令卡展示的指令依次执行。6.一种寻线玩具中的指令同步处理系统,其特征在于,包括:模块m1:在第一时间段中,寻线获取第一线路上的指令卡展示的指令,并按照队列的数据结构存储指令,得到第一指令队列;模块m2:在第二时间段中,触发所述第一指令队列中的指令依次执行,并实时触发实时寻线移动获取的第二线路上的指令卡展示的指令;其中,所述第二时间段晚于第一时间段。7.根据权利要求6所述的寻线玩具中的指令同步处理系统,其特征在于,所述模块m1包括:
模块m1.1:记录从第一线路上寻线获取到各对相邻指令卡展现指令之间的时间间隔;模块m1.2:根据所述时间间隔,对所述第一指令队列中的指令标注触发执行的时间点,相邻指令的时间点之间时间的间隔等于对应的所述时间间隔。在所述模块m2中,按照所述时间点,触发所述第一指令队列中的指令依次执行;其中,第一线路的寻线速率与第二线路的寻线速率相等。8.根据权利要求7所述的寻线玩具中的指令同步处理系统,其特征在于,所述模块m2包括:模块m2.1:在第二线路上获取延时执行指令卡展示的延时指令;模块m2.2:按照所述延时指令指示的时间,触发所述第一指令队列中的第一个指令开始执行。9.根据权利要求8所述的寻线玩具中的指令同步处理系统,其特征在于,还包括:模块ma:在第三时间段中,在第二线路上寻路移动,获取延时执行指令卡展示的延时指令;模块mb:在第三时间段中,按照所述延时指令指示的时间,暂停后继续寻路移动;模块mc:在第三时间段中,在所述时间点时进行暂停后继续寻路移动,直到停留在第一指令队列中的最后一个时间点时的位置;其中,所述暂停时经过的时间,不计入相邻指令的时间点之间时间的间隔;所述暂停时经过的时间大于等于1秒钟;所述第三时间段位于所述第一时间段与第二时间段之间,或者,所述第三时间段位于所述第二时间段之后。10.根据权利要求6所述的寻线玩具中的指令同步处理系统,其特征在于,第一线路与第二线路为同一条线路或者为不同的线路;第一线路上获取的指令卡的尺寸相等于第二线路上获取的指令卡的尺寸;在所述模块m2中,触发所述第一指令队列中的无间隔排列的指令卡展示的指令依次执行,并实时触发第二线路上的无间隔排列的指令卡展示的指令依次执行。11.一种存储有计算机程序的计算机可读存储介质,其特征在于,所述计算机程序被处理器执行时实现权利要求1至5中任一项所述的寻线玩具中的指令同步处理方法的步骤。12.一种寻线玩具,其特征在于,所述寻线玩具采用权利要求1至5中任一项所述的寻线玩具中的指令同步处理方法,或者包括权利要求6至10中任一项所述的寻线玩具中的指令同步处理系统,或者包括权利要求11所述的存储有计算机程序的计算机可读存储介质。

技术总结
本发明提供了一种寻线玩具中的指令同步处理方法和系统,包括:在第一时间段中,寻线获取第一线路上的指令卡展示的指令,并按照队列的数据结构存储指令,得到第一指令队列;在第二时间段中,触发所述第一指令队列中的指令依次执行,并实时触发实时寻线移动获取的第二线路上的指令卡展示的指令;其中,所述第二时间段晚于第一时间段。本发明中先后读取两套指令,并令两套指令在同一时间段内一起执行,解决了提高寻线玩具读取并执行指令卡的频率的问题。问题。问题。


技术研发人员:高超 李善俊 赵家亮 江一鸣 高宇
受保护的技术使用者:上海布鲁可积木科技有限公司
技术研发日:2022.09.20
技术公布日:2022/11/25
当前第2页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1